The relationship between the transgender community and LGBTQ+ culture is dynamic and continuously evolving. True solidarity within the culture requires active allyship from cisgender lesbian, gay, and bisexual individuals. The 1980s and 1990s saw a growing movement within the LGBTQ community to address the specific needs and concerns of transgender individuals. This period was marked by the emergence of organizations such as the Tri-Essence, a group focused on supporting transgender women, and the National Center for Transgender Equality (NCTE), which aimed to advocate for policy changes and provide resources for the transgender community.
